It may not be thrush. It's often what happens when you are on a liquid diet. Because you aren't chewing food, which scrapes across your tongue in the process of eating, you develop kind of a film. Gross, but usually not thrush and nothing that won't go away when you can eat food again. Have you tried a tongue scraper? Brushing didn't work for me, but a tongue scraper got about 70% of the gross off. As soon as I was chewing or even on soft foods again, my tongue went back to its normal pink self. Thrush can be caused by some antibiotics that throw off the chemistry in your mouth (kind of the same way it works with yeast infections of the lady parts), but in adults a lot of times it happens more with people who are immune-compromised. Not saying you def don't have thrush, but I had exactly what you described during the liquid phase, and I had it once before when I went on a slimfast for a month diet, and the mechanical act of chewing food fixed it almost immediately.
